How it decides — six Nansen endpoints, first matching rule wins

  1. 1search/general0 cr

    is a token contract deployed at this address?

    contract route at 0 credits, search over

  2. 2profiler/address/transactions1–2 cr

    transfers in and out, the sweep hashes; HTTP 422 = burn

    burn, dormant, poisoning, which txs to look up (+1 cr all-time page when quiet)

  3. 3profiler/address/counterparties5 cr

    who it pays and how much of the outflow

    100 % to one wallet = the sweep signature

  4. 4profiler/address/related-wallets1–2 cr

    Deployed by, Created by, First Funder relations

    contract vs your own wallet (+1 cr on your address)

  5. 5profiler/address/first-funder1 cr

    who paid its first gas, and in which tx

    exchange gas dripper vs you

  6. 6transaction-with-token-transfer-lookup1 cr × ≤4

    entity labels on the transfer: 🏦 Binance: Deposit

    the route
